F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E SUSPECTED LOCAL SERIAL BANK ROBBER SOUGHT BY FBICharlotte, NC – An unknown suspect has been linked to at least 6 bank robberies in the Charlotte area and the FBI, through its Safe Streets Task Force comprising of agents and officers from Charlotte-Mecklenburg Police Department and Mecklenburg County Sheriff’s Office, is requesting the public’s assistance. The suspect is identified as a black or white male (often white make-up is used), mid-30’s, approximately 5’7”-5’8” and between 150-160 pounds. The suspect has repeatedly worn dark sunglasses, a fake, light-colored wig and beard, gloves and often a brimmed hat. Most notably is that the suspect has brandished a silver colored semi-automatic pistol during the robberies, and is considered to be armed and dangerous. Agents and officers suspect this could be a two person team (one white and one black male) as the suspect’s demeanor in the banks is not consistent, along with slightly different physical descriptions by witnesses.
